Architecture award for Perth Creative Exchange
Perth Creative Exchange, the shiny new hub for artists in the city centre, has been named winner of a prize for regeneration projects at the Scottish Property Awards 2021.

New Highland entrepreneurs share online lessons as HIE programme marks three years of success

A business growth programme aimed at nurturing life sciences and technology businesses in the Highlands and Islands is celebrating the completion of its third year by hearing from some of those who have gained from taking part.
The fully funded Pathfinder Accelerator programme was developed by Highlands and Islands Enterprise (HIE) to help businesses bring new ideas to market quicker and today s online event will bring together Pathfinder alumni from the past and present as well as speakers from across the UK, among them Rachel Hanretty, founder of Mademoiselle Macaron. ....
